Abstract
This paper proposes a position sensorless control scheme for four-switch three-phase (FSTP) brushless dc (BLDC) motor drives using a field programmable gate array (FPGA).A novel sensorless control with six commutation modes and novel pulsewidth modulation scheme is developed to drive FSTP BLDC motors.The low cost BLDC driver is achieved by the reduction of switch device count, cost down of control, and saving of hall sensors.The feasibility of the proposed sensorless control for FSTP BLDC motor drives is demonstrated by analysis and experimental results.Index Terms-Brushless dc (BLDC) motor, four-switch threephase (FSTP) inverter, field programmable gate array (FPGA), sensorless control. I. INTRODUCTIONR ECENTLY, the brushless dc (BLDC) motor is becoming popular in various applications because of its high efficiency, high power factor, high torque, simple control, and lower maintenance.Conventionally, BLDC motors are excited by a six-switch inverter as shown in Fig. 1.However, cost-effective design is becoming one of the most important concerns for the modern motor control research.Some researchers [1]-[6] developed new power inverters with reduced losses and costs.Among these developments, the three-phase voltage source inverters with only four switches, as shown in Fig. 2, is an attractive solution.In comparison with the usual three-phase voltage-source inverter with six switches, the main features of this converter are twofold: the first is the reduction of switches and freewheeling diode count; the second is the reduction of conduction losses.J.-H Lee et al.[4] and B.-Kuk Lee et al.[5] both developed BLDC motor drives with trapezoidal back electromotive force (EMF) using the four-switch three-phase (FSTP) inverter: The four-space-vector scheme was used in [4], and in [5] the six commutation modes based on current control.They used position sensors to achieve commutation control of BLDC motors.However, position sensors make the total system more expensive, larger in volume, and less reliable.On the other hand, sensorless control for six-switch three-phase BLDC motors has had many successful applications.
